About Tura

Old Norse in origin, the name Tura derives from the Old Norse name Þórir. This name is a variant of Thor (Þórr), the Norse god of thunder and lightning. Another possible origin is the Proto-Norse *"Þunra-wíhaR," composed of the elements "þónr" (thunder) and "wīhaR / wīha"** (fighter or holy).
